From 46f004c980062d7b9850e83ba0c449b65fc9bed3 Mon Sep 17 00:00:00 2001
From: "jan.middendorf@rwth-aachen.de" <jan.middendorf@rwth-aachen.de>
Date: Tue, 19 May 2020 13:04:51 +0200
Subject: [PATCH] Python 3 compatibility

---
 keras.py | 10 +++++-----
 1 file changed, 5 insertions(+), 5 deletions(-)

diff --git a/keras.py b/keras.py
index d1cc708..8668f2e 100644
--- a/keras.py
+++ b/keras.py
@@ -1,4 +1,4 @@
-from itertools import izip
+#from itertools import izip
 from collections import OrderedDict, defaultdict
 import fnmatch
 import numpy as np
@@ -7,12 +7,12 @@ from tqdm import tqdm
 from inspect import getargspec
 from warnings import warn
 import re
-from tensorflow.python.keras.engine.training_utils import make_logs
+#from tensorflow.python.keras.engine.training_utils import make_logs
 from tensorflow.python.keras.backend import track_variable
 from operator import itemgetter
 
-from evil import pin
-from data import SKDict, DSS
+from .evil import pin
+from .data import SKDict, DSS
 
 # various helper functions
 
@@ -188,7 +188,7 @@ class Moment2Std(tf.keras.callbacks.Callback):
     def on_x_end(self, x, logs=None):
         if logs is None:
             return
-        for key1, mom1 in logs.items():
+        for key1, mom1 in list(logs.items()):
             if not key1.endswith(self.mom1):
                 continue
             prefix = key1[:-len(self.mom1)]
-- 
GitLab